The Path to AI Agents: From Assistants to Execution

Traditional automation systems, such as RPA or script-based assistants, work well only in strictly formalized processes. But as soon as a task deviates from the template, or a complex solution is required that involves data from different systems, automation hits a ceiling. The employee still has to switch between dozens of interfaces, manually collect information, and make decisions.

This is why SAP adopted the concept of AI agents. These are not just chatbots or assistants that provide information, but full-fledged executors embedded in key business processes. They are capable of not only analyzing data but also performing multi-step workflows, making decisions based on regulations, and interacting with each other to solve complex problems.

How AI Agents Were Designed: Layered Architecture

The AI agent in the SAP Joule Studio concept is not a monolithic system, but an orchestrator consisting of specialized agents. Each such agent is an expert in its domain: finance, HR, logistics, IT. They act autonomously, yet are capable of collaboration to solve complex tasks.

Key design principles:

  • Embedding into processes. AI agents are integrated directly into core SAP applications (HANA Cloud, S/4HANA Cloud, Concur, LeanIX, and others), rather than existing as standalone tools. This allows them to work with context and data in real-time.
  • Multi-agent interaction. Instead of a single universal agent, a network of specialized agents is created that can exchange information and delegate tasks to each other. For example, to resolve a payment dispute, collection, invoicing, and customer support agents can interact.
  • Role-based assistants. For user convenience, role-based AI assistants are introduced that automatically invoke the necessary agents depending on the employee's task. A financial manager forecasting cash flows receives relevant data and actions without having to manually select an agent.
  • Knowledge Graph. At the core of the agents' work is the SAP Knowledge Graph, which connects and organizes data from various SAP applications. This allows agents not just to search for information, but to understand the relationships between business entities (invoices, orders, customers) and make decisions taking into account the context.

Implementation: From Point Solutions to End-to-End Automation

The implementation of SAP Joule Studio AI agents occurs in stages. It began with the development of a low-code/no-code environment (Joule Studio in SAP Build) for creating custom agent skills, allowing companies to adapt them to their needs. This was followed by an expansion of development capabilities and integration with SAP analytical solutions for real-time data processing.

In practice, this means that implementation starts with the most obvious and routine tasks where the effect of automation is immediately visible. For example, a receipt analysis agent in Concur Expense automatically fills in missing expense details from receipt images. As employees see the value and convenience, implementation extends to more complex processes, including finance management, HR, and supply chains.

An important aspect is integration with external systems, such as Microsoft 365 Copilot, which allows agents to exchange data and skills between different ecosystems, creating a unified workspace.

Results: Figures and Prospects

Area Function Effect
Finance Cash Management 70% reduction in reconciliation time
Procurement Supplier Bid Analysis Elimination of manual spreadsheet analysis, automatic selection of best options
Supply Chain Production Planning Automated validation and release of orders, acceleration of cycles
General Business Tasks AI Agent Support Forecast of up to 80% of most used tasks by 2026

Beyond specific figures, SAP envisions a shift towards "autonomous enterprises" where business processes require minimal human intervention. This means more efficient supply chains, automated transactions, and proactive error handling. Employees are freed from repetitive tasks, gaining the opportunity to focus on strategic initiatives and tasks requiring creative thinking.
